Tokyo Metro Ginza Line “Trend Area” Station Design Competition

Regarding the renewal project of Ginza Line whose 90th anniversary will come in 2017, Tokyo Metro Co., Ltd. has been holding a series of design competitions since December 2012, which invites various ideas to make the Ginza Line more attractive.

Following the last competition for “Business Area,” the 5th edition of TOKYO METRO GINZA LINE STATION DESIGN COMPETITION will feature “TREND AREA” of the Aoyama-itchome, Gaiemmae, and Omote-sando stations. Tokyo Metro invites proposals widely.

“TREND AREA” where new trends are always being created, attracts many foreign tourists and early adopters. We would like you all to propose the “station design ” and the “favorable user experience” which is forward-looking and anticipating the future after 2020, so that the very experience of using the Tokyo Metro could turn into a “TREND”.

Tokyo Metro Co., Ltd. have been continuously pursuing “Safety” and providing passenger–centric high quality services. Determining that all passengers should use our lines without any concerns, we are promoting various measures of both hardware & software to reach a “world-top-level” metro.

TOKYO METRO GINZA LINE, “TREND AREA”
Aoyama-itchome station, Gaiemmae station, Omote-sando station

The “station design” suitable to foster a favorable user experience includes floors/walls/ceilings/lighting of the platforms (for Aoyama-itchome station, Gaiemmae station, Omote-sando station), the ticket gate area (for Aoyama-itchome station, Gaiemmae station, Omote-sando station), and the entrance (for Aoyama-itchome station). The following proposals are invited: 
1) Proposals that create favorable and functional passenger experiences at each station.
2) Proposals for the platform that are unique and practical to each station.
3) Proposals for the ticket gates as the face of each station.
4) Proposals for the entrances that connect the underground station to the aboveground city.
